NSA Summer 2027 Internship Program - Business Management & Acquisition - Entry - Maryland
About the Role
The NSA Summer Internship Program at Fort Meade, MD offers students paid professional work opportunities to grow their knowledge of the Intelligence Community and federal government while advancing NSA's two primary missions: collecting, analyzing, and producing foreign signals intelligence; and providing cybersecurity solutions and guidance to protect critical national infrastructure. These opportunities are open to students pursuing a variety of degree programs.
Business Management and Acquisition Track
Interns in this track will train and gain experience within a multifaceted business organization and work directly with seasoned business professionals. Interns will build knowledge and skills on the fundamental concepts of government planning, programming, budgeting and execution; preparing and processing contractual agreements; using business IT systems and tools; gaining a working knowledge of the Agency's acquisition processes; learning fundamentals of cost and price analysis of proposals; and using financial principles to identify trends in data.

Qualifications
- Must be a U.S. Citizen
- Must be enrolled in a degree-seeking program (undergraduate, graduate, doctorate) at time of application
- Specific education requirements vary by program
- Preferred cumulative GPA of 3.0 or higher
- Must be eligible to be granted a TS/SCI security clearance after successfully completing a background investigation, a Full-scope Polygraph and a Psychological Evaluation
- Must be available and in the U.S. for operational and technical interviews and other applicable processing, both in-person and via telephone/internet, between the months of October 2026 and April 2027

Pay and Benefits
- Students are paid a competitive salary commensurate with their education level
- All internships are 10–12 weeks during the summer
- Receive annual leave, sick leave and paid federal holidays
- Students who attend school in excess of 75 miles from Fort Meade, MD are eligible for housing accommodations and travel entitlements of a round trip airfare ticket to and from school or mileage reimbursement up to the cost of a government-issued airline ticket
- Daily transportation to and from work is NOT provided. Students participating in the program are highly encouraged to bring a vehicle. Carpooling with other students MAY be available, but is NOT guaranteed
